When pouring a drink for someone, Keeping your wrist using your other hand will make the gesture far more respectful.

Korean cuisine is celebrated all over the world for its bold flavors and varied dishes. Kimchi, a spicy fermented cabbage dish, is usually a staple in Korean households plus a image of the nation?�s culinary id.

Regardless of their intertwined historical past and mutual influences, Chinese, Japanese, and Korean artwork are Each individual distinct in their particular way. By way of example, papermaking was distribute from China to Korea and Japan, while Korean artisans had been kidnapped to Japan while in the late sixteenth century and premiered selected Japanese pottery models.
